«Do Ya» is a mesmerizing track recorded by the talented K.T. Oslin. The song was written by her and produced by Harold Shedd. It was featured on her debut album, «80’s Ladies,» which was released in 1987. This masterpiece quickly made its way to the top of the charts, reaching the 1nd position on the Billboard Hot Country Singles & Tracks chart and the 3st position on the Canadian RPM Country Tracks chart.
